3. Fact-Checking and Verification Tools
In the age of misinformation, fact-checking and verification tools are indispensable for ensuring the accuracy of news. These resources help users distinguish between credible information and fake news.
Popular Fact-Checking Resources
- Snopes: One of the oldest and most trusted fact-checking websites, providing detailed analyses of viral stories and claims.
- FactCheck.org: A nonpartisan, nonprofit website that aims to reduce the level of deception and confusion in U.S. politics.
- PolitiFact: Known for its "Truth-O-Meter," this resource evaluates the accuracy of claims made by politicians and public figures.
By incorporating these tools into your news consumption routine, you can better navigate the complex landscape of digital information and make informed decisions.
